	<title><![CDATA[Compact Power and The Home Depot Launch New Equipment Center in Charlotte]]></title>
    <link>http://www.cpiequipment.com/Compact-Power-and-The-Home-Depot-Launch-New-Equipm/news-14</link>    
	<description><![CDATA[<p>Compact Power, Inc. and The Home Depot have partnered to create a new equipment center that, following a successful local launch, could expand to serve do-it-yourselfers and outdoor contractors nationwide.</p><p>Featuring the Boxer line of mini-skid steer loaders, the first Compact Power Equipment Centers opened March 24, 2008 at The Home Depot stores in three Charlotte-area locations.</p><p>&ldquo;The Compact Power Equipment Center is a new one-stop source for labor-saving equipment, whether you&rsquo;re a homeowner eager to tackle a basic landscaping project, or a professional contractor wanting to make the tough jobs easier,&rdquo; said Compact Power CEO Roger Braswell, who owned a landscaping business for many years.&nbsp; &ldquo;As a local company, Compact Power is very excited to kick off this venture with The Home Depot right here in Charlotte, and we look forward to rolling it out in other cities over the coming years.&rdquo;</p><p>Braswell noted that the Compact Power Equipment Center operates on four basic principles: (1) fast check-in and check-out, (2) friendly and expert customer service, (3) broad selection of the best equipment brands and (4) fair prices and policies for renting, buying or financing equipment.</p><p>In addition to Boxer mini-skid steer loaders, the Compact Power Equipment Center offers IHI mini excavators, ASV loaders, Ventrac multi-purpose tractors, Carlton tree removal equipment, Z Spray aerators and sprayers, Land Pride utility vehicles and ProHauler trailers.</p><p>The most versatile type of power equipment, a mini skid-steer loader can be used with various attachments for digging, tilling, drilling, hauling and other tasks.</p><p>Braswell invited Charlotte-area residents to check out the new Compact Power Equipment Center.&nbsp; &ldquo;Homeowners undertaking a landscaping project will find power equipment that is easy to transport and use, along with experts who can answer questions and provide sound guidance.&nbsp; Contractors will find equipment that meets all their needs and experts who understand their business, whether it&rsquo;s landscaping, fencing, pools, masonry or irrigation.&rdquo;</p><p>The Home Depot stores with a Compact Power Equipment Center are located at 2815 Home Depot Blvd., Rock Hill, SC; 1837 Matthews Township, Matthews, NC; and 10210 Centrum Parkway, Pineville, NC.&nbsp; A fourth center is located at Compact Power&rsquo;s local headquarters, 3326 Highway 51, Fort Mill,. SC</p>]]></description>

	<title><![CDATA[Compact Power Announces Acquisition of DOC Machine Tool Services]]></title>
    <link>http://www.cpiequipment.com/Compact-Power-Announces-Acquisition-of-DOC-Machine/news-4</link>    
	<description><![CDATA[<p>FT. MILL, SC, FEBRUARY 5, 2007 - Compact Power, Inc. (&quot;CPI&quot;) and its subsidiary companies have announced the acquisition of certain assets of DOC Machine Tool Services of South Carolina, Inc., a South Carolina-based full-service maintenance corporation (&quot;DOC&quot;). Roger Braswell, Compact Power CEO, stated &quot;the acquisition of the DOC business will better allow CPI to meet the technical and service support needs of our growing customer base, including DOC&#39;s customers.&quot;<br /><br />The relationship between CPI and DOC began by working together servicing equipment for The Home Depot Tool Rental. DOC has helped support CPI&#39;s growing large equipment service demands by utilizing their national network of service technicians. In addition to servicing Home Depot, DOC also maintains strong customer relations with Newell Rubbermaid, Levolor Kirsch, Wal-Mart, Best Buy, General Electric, Siemans and Vought.<br /><br />DOC was founded in1988 with a primary focus on field service in the Machine Tool industry. Over the next twelve years, DOC expanded its service offerings to include machine tool rebuild, retrofit and contract maintenance. In the early 2000&#39;s, DOC seized an opportunity to enter into the light industrial market, offering total service solutions including nationwide service, call center capabilities and parts management. Today, DOC continues to provide superior local service nationwide for both the heavy and light industrial markets.<br /><br />Specializing in stand-on skid steers such as the PowerHouse&reg; and Boxer&reg; brands; CPI has become a manufacturer and international distributor of these products to contractors, landscapers, homeowners and national retailers. Founded in late 2003, CPI has seen product sales and production triple in its first three years in the compact construction equipment industry. The company has established itself as a national and international leader in the compact equipment market.<br /><br />Compact Power Services, LLC will operate the business of DOC and will join the CPI business group, which includes ProHauler Trailers of Ft. Mill, SC and Mertz Manufacturing of Ponca City, OK.</p>]]></description>

	<title><![CDATA[Boxer Adds 22 HP Diesel Mini-Skid to Product Line]]></title>
    <link>http://www.cpiequipment.com/Boxer-Adds-22-HP-Diesel-Mini--Skid-to-Product-Line/news-5</link>    
	<description><![CDATA[<p>CPECdirect.com and Compact Power Equipment Centers to carry the newest addition to the BOXER mini-skid product line with the 322D. The new 322D mini-skid offers the robust power that Boxer is famous for, only in a smaller, lighter package. The 322D accepts all of the same standard attachments as the larger Boxer models.&nbsp; It is&nbsp; designed to cater to the unique needs of landscape contractors, homeowners and especially the rental market (hire market) due to the ease of operation, smaller footprint and exceptional lifting power.<br /><br />&quot;Diesel is important to many of our customers both domestic and international, with great emphasis on the latter.&nbsp; Some countries we do business in just won&#39;t accept gasoline engines in their fleet.&nbsp; In these locations diesel is easier to find and considered to be a superior fuel. It isn&#39;t my job to change these perspectives. &nbsp; It is my job to cater to the wishes of our customers.&quot; - Andy Lewis, Director of Marketing Communications, Compact Power Equipment Centers.</p><p>The 322D fills a niche market for those seeking robust lifting power but still want a smaller more nimble machine.&nbsp; The 322D is a perfect assimilation of strength and speed. &nbsp; See attached spec sheet for more details.</p>]]></description>
